LaRoyce Hawkins Departs NBC's 'Chicago P.D.' After 13 Seasons

LaRoyce Hawkins, an original cast member of the NBC police procedural 'Chicago P.D.', is departing the series as a regular after 13 seasons. Hawkins is slated to return for the initial two to three episodes of the upcoming Season 14 to conclude his character Kevin Atwater's storyline. The departure marks the end of an era for the show, which has featured Hawkins since its inception.
'Chicago P.D.' is currently in the process of casting a new series regular to fill the void left by Hawkins' exit. The series, which premiered in 2014, has seen several cast changes over its extensive run. Hawkins' portrayal of Officer Kevin Atwater has been a consistent presence, contributing to the show's established ensemble cast. The decision for his departure comes as the series heads into its fourteenth season.
Details regarding the specific circumstances of Hawkins' exit or his future projects were not immediately available. However, his planned return for a limited arc suggests a narrative conclusion for his character rather than an abrupt departure. The show's production team will be working to integrate his final episodes seamlessly into the season's narrative arc. The series is produced by Universal Television, a division of Universal Studio Group.
